Q: How is this automotive insulation fabric typically installed and where can it be applied in a vehicle?
A: These insulation fabrics are delivered in 30-50 meter rolls and can be cut to size for placement. They are commonly installed in engine compartments, car hoods, door panels, floor mats, and around exhaust systems due to their flexible, non-woven texture, making application straightforward during vehicle assembly or refurbishment.
Q: What benefits does the fiberglass and ceramic fiber blend provide over conventional insulation materials?
A: The unique blend of fiberglass and ceramic fiber ensures high tensile strength, superior heat resistance up to 1100C, and outstanding acoustic absorption, while remaining lightweight and flexible. This combination offers better performance compared to traditional foam or felt insulation.
Q: When should automotive manufacturers or repair shops use this fabric for vehicle insulation?
A: This insulation fabric is ideal for use during initial vehicle manufacturing or during retrofitting and repairs, especially when upgrading heat and sound insulation in critical areas such as engine bays and interior panels that require durable, flame-retardant, and high-performance materials.
Q: What process is involved in producing this automotive insulation fabric?
A: The fabric is produced using a needle-punched technique, incorporating a plain, non-woven style. This process binds fiberglass and ceramic fibers to achieve an optimal balance of softness, density (up to 1200 gsm), and durability. Optional aluminum foil coatings are applied to improve thermal reflection capabilities.
